Abstract

The invention relates to an adjustable support device (1) for furniture, suitable for being associated with a plate forming a side (F) of a piece of furniture for adjusting the position of the piece of furniture along an adjustment axis (Y-Y) substantially vertical with respect to a support surface. The device (1) comprises a mounting element (2) which can be fixed to an inner surface (F1) of said side portion (F) of the piece of furniture by means of at least one pair of fixing screws (13), said mounting element (2) comprising a central body (20) defining a through seat (20A) extending along said adjustment axis (Y-Y) and provided with an internal thread (20B), and an adjustment device (3) provided with a threaded rod (31) extending along said adjustment axis (Y-Y) and adapted to engage with said through seat (20A) of said mounting element (2), said adjustment device (3) being adapted to rest a first end (32) on said support surface and to operate in an axially rotatable manner to adjust, in use, the position of said side portion (F) with respect to said support surface. In particular, the device (1) further comprises a support insert (7) coupled with said mounting element (2) and defining at least one pair of housing seats (70) having an extension substantially orthogonal in use with respect to the inner surface (F1) of said side (F), each of said housing seats (70) supporting a respective one of said previously arranged fixing screws (13) in a pre-mounted position.

Technical Field
The present invention relates to an adjustable support device for furniture, such as in particular a support foot adapted to be associated with a plate forming a side of a piece of furniture, for adjusting the vertical position of the furniture with respect to a substantially horizontal support surface, such as a floor.
Background
The support foot is adapted to adjust the vertical position of a furniture piece arranged on a support surface, the purpose of which is to compensate for possible irregularities of the support surface, as is well known in the industry. In particular, the support foot generally comprises two members, one inserted into the other, which can be axially slid relative to each other by means of an adjustment mechanism, which can be actuated using a suitable operating tool; the mutual movement between the two members allows the height of the furniture piece to be adjusted.
Typically, one of the members is integrally joined to the support surface, while the other member is adapted to engage a portion of the furniture piece, typically the side and/or bottom panels, and to restrain the other member thereto by suitable securing means.
To restrain a support device of the above type to the side of a piece of furniture, it is generally necessary to bring the device close to the inner surface of the side and in the vicinity of the lower edge, and then to insert them at the lower edge surface of the thickness portion, either by using reference pins or by press-fitting appropriate reference teeth in the thickness portion of the plate, so as to achieve the desired fitting position.
This is then accomplished by using one or more set screws which are inserted into suitable openings formed in the body of the device, with the screws being arranged in a direction substantially transverse to the inner surface of the side portions, and then screwed directly into the plate forming the side portions, in order to ensure the stability of the foot, in particular when the furniture piece is under load.
In this case, however, the assembly technician needs to choose the type and size of the screws used to secure the support feet to the sides of the furniture piece. Furthermore, the assembly technician may insert the screw into the plate in an incorrect direction.

Detailed Description
Referring to the above figures, there is shown an adjustable support device 1 according to the invention, suitable for being associated with a plate forming a side F of a furniture piece for supporting the furniture piece on a substantially flat and horizontal support surface, such as for example a floor, so as to allow adjustment of the vertical position of the furniture piece, i.e. along an adjustment axis Y-Y substantially perpendicular to said support surface.
In the following description, expressions such as "above", "below", "upper", "lower", "high", "low", "horizontal", "vertical", and the like will be used; those skilled in the art will readily understand that these expressions relate to the orientation of the support device 1 in the normal operating configuration, i.e. in use, as shown in the accompanying drawings.
As shown in fig. 1A, 1B, 2A and 2B, said device 1 comprises a mounting element 2 which can be fixed to the inner surface F1 of the side F of the piece of furniture by means of fixing means 13, the mounting element 2 being provided with a central body 20, the central body 20 defining a through seat 20A extending along said adjustment axis Y-Y, substantially vertical in use, and the through seat 20A being advantageously provided with an internal thread 20B adapted to engage with an adjustment device 3 provided with a threaded rod 31, the end of which rests on said support surface and is adapted to operate in an axially rotatable manner, so as to adjust the position of said side F with respect to the support surface.
Advantageously, said adjustment means 3 have, at a first end of said threaded rod 31, a head 32 which, in use, is substantially directed towards the support surface, which head is preferably flat and enlarged, and can be associated by snap-coupling with a support base 4 configured to expand the surface area of the support means 1 on the support surface as much as possible, in order to unload the weight of the furniture piece in an optimal way.
At the opposite end of the rod 31, said adjustment means 3 preferably comprise a shaped seating 33A, which can engage with the tip of a suitable tool, suitable for applying an axial rotation to the rod 31 in the screwing/unscrewing direction, so as to adjust the position of the side F in the direction defined by said axis Y-Y.
Alternatively, advantageously, inside said shaped seat 33A, an engagement element 5 can be arranged, configured to receive the tip of an adjustment tool and transfer the rotation transmitted by the adjustment tool to the rod 31 of the adjustment device 3.
Said internal thread 20B, suitably of opposite shape to the thread of said rod 31, can be formed directly in the through seat 20A, so that, in use of the device 1, the rotation transmitted to the adjustment device 3 will cause the sliding of the mounting element 2 along the thread of said rod 31 and thus the adjustment of the position of the side F of the piece of furniture integrally joined to the mounting element along said adjustment axis Y-Y.
According to an advantageous embodiment of the invention, said device 1 comprises connection means 6 adapted to operatively connect said adjustment means 3 and said mounting element 2.
Advantageously, said connection means 6 define a through cavity 60A extending, in use, along said axis Y-Y, on which said internal thread 20B can be formed, so as to form a nut screw for said adjustment screw 3.
The connecting means 6 are therefore suitable for being mounted in advance on the rod 31 of the adjusting means 3 and for being seated in the through seat 20A of the mounting element 2, suitable for being integrally joined with the mounting element 2 by means of first coupling means 61, the first coupling means 61 being formed, for example, by pairs of elastically deformable wings which project from the connecting means 6 and respectively have, at the respective free ends, engagement teeth suitable for being inserted in a snap-fit manner into suitable engagement holes 26 provided on the mounting element 2.
Advantageously, said connection means 6 are formed by pairs of half-shells 6A, 6B, respectively carrying respective portions of said internal thread 20B, which can be mutually coupled by means of second coupling means 62 when the device 1 is assembled in a direction orthogonal to the axis Y-Y, for example, the second coupling means 62 being formed by a pair of wings projecting from one of the half-shells and adapted to be snap-fitted with opposite engagement seats 63 formed on the other half-shell, so as to form a closed and compact shell in which said through cavity 60A is defined.
In this way, advantageously, the connection means 6 can be associated with the threaded rod 31 of the adjustment means 3 without screwing, simply by positioning the first half-shell along the rod 31 and then snap-coupling the other half-shell.
Advantageously, the internal thread 20B of the through cavity 60A has an interruption at the upper end portion, so as to create an end of stroke which prevents the complete unscrewing of the adjustment device 3 by the mounting element 2.
In this way, by using a suitable tool to engage the shaped seat 33A or by means of the engagement element 5, a rotation in the screwing/unscrewing direction applied to the adjustment device 3 will cause the connection device 6 to slide along the threaded rod 31 of the adjustment device 3 and thus the mounting element 2, which mounting element 2 is mounted in use in an integrally joined manner with the side F, so that a desired adjustment of the piece of furniture along the Y-Y axis can be obtained with respect to the supporting surface of the piece of furniture.
Advantageously, said support device 1 can be fixed to the inner surface F1 of the side F of the piece of furniture, preferably the support device 1 is fixed to the inner surface F1 of the side F of the piece of furniture in the vicinity of the lower edge of the side, which is close to the floor in use. For this purpose, said mounting element 2 is advantageously fitted with a coupling flange 21 lying on the first plane P1 and adapted to be arranged, in use, to rest against said inner surface F1 of said side portion F.
Preferably, the coupling flange 21 is formed by a separate pair of flat portions, advantageously formed as a single piece with said central body 20, separated from the opposite sides of the central body and configured such that, in use, it lies on said first plane P1, substantially vertical, so as to rest against the inner surface F1 of said sides F.
Furthermore, said coupling flange 21 is advantageously provided with suitable through fixing holes 21A, in which fixing means 13, such as screws, can be inserted, so as to allow the device 1 to be stably fixed to the side F of the piece of furniture. Preferably, the pair of parts forming the coupling flange 21 each have at least one fixing hole 21A.
According to an advantageous feature of the invention, the device further comprises a support insert 7, preferably made of polymeric material, which can be associated with the mounting element 2 and is configured to define at least one pair of housing seats 70, the housing seats 70 having, in use, an extension substantially orthogonal with respect to the first plane P1 and therefore with respect to the inner surface F1 of the side portion F, on which the portion forming the coupling flange 21 is located, each housing seat 70 being adapted to house and support a respective fixing screw 13 in the assembled position.
In other words, said support insert 7 allows to provide the support device 1 with fixing screws 13 more suitable for the particular use, which are advantageously arranged in advance in suitable pre-installation positions, in order to facilitate and rapidly fix the support device to the side F of the furniture piece.
Preferably, said housing seats 70 are each substantially formed with a channel 72, which channel 72 is open at one end in order to allow the insertion of the respective screw 13, and is closed at the opposite end with a bottom wall 71 lying on a substantially vertical plane, on which bottom wall 71A pre-mounted through hole 71A is formed.
The insert 7 further comprises a connecting portion 73 adapted to connect a pair of said housing seats 70 with a guiding and retaining means 74, such as for example a pair of preferably slightly inclined surfaces arranged and configured to cooperate with opposite inclined surfaces formed on the mounting element 2 to guide the coupling in a direction substantially orthogonal to the first plane P1 and to retain the coupling position achieved by interference.
Advantageously, when the insert 7 is associated with the mounting element 2, the connecting portion 73 extends around the central body 20 of the mounting element 2, so that the seats 70 are arranged in parallel and at opposite sides of the connecting portion, wherein the bottom wall 71 substantially abuts the coupling flange 21 and the pre-mounting holes 71A are substantially aligned with the fixing holes 21A.
Advantageously, the support device 1 further comprises reference means 8 adapted to allow a correct positioning and orientation of the mounting element 2 and to temporarily hold it in place before fixing it to the side F.
Preferably, said reference means 8 comprise a support flange 22, which support flange 22 is preferably formed by a pair of flat portions protruding from the lower edges of the pair of said portions forming said coupling flange 21 and lying on the same second substantially horizontal plane P2.
The support flange 22 is adapted to be inserted under a plate forming a side F of a furniture piece and cooperates to abut against a lower edge surface F2 of the side, thus forming an assembly reference and advantageously improving the load-bearing capacity of the device 1.
According to an advantageous feature of the invention, each of the portions forming the support flange 22 has at least one reference tooth 23, preferably in pairs, at the end free edge, projecting substantially orthogonally with respect to the relative portion and adapted to be press-fitted into the thickness of the plate forming the side of the piece of furniture, inserted from the lower edge surface F2 of this side, in order to firmly hold the mounting element 2 in place before it is stably fixed to the side F using the screw 13.
Preferably, as can be better seen from fig. 3A and 3B, said reference tooth 23 is arranged in a substantially mirror-image manner with respect to a plane of symmetry substantially orthogonal to said first plane P1, and the reference tooth 23 is located on a third plane P3, advantageously inclined with respect to said first plane P1 by an angle α, preferably comprised between 30 ° and 60 °.
In this way, advantageously, when the reference tooth is inserted from the lower edge surface F2 of the side portion F and said reference tooth 23 is press-fitted into the thickness portion of the side portion F, the reference tooth 23 is oriented along a plane inclined with respect to the inner and outer surfaces of the side portion F, preventing the inner and outer surfaces from deviating, in particular when the piece of furniture is under load, thus limiting the risk of breakage of the plate.
In an alternative embodiment, not shown in the figures, said reference means 8 may comprise at least one pin protruding from said mounting element 2, and preferably a pair of pins protruding from said coupling flange 21, which pins may be inserted into corresponding engagement seats suitably arranged on the inner surface F1 of the side portion F, so as to define a correct positioning of the mounting element before fixing the mounting element 2.
Thus, the support device 1 has been assembled when provided to the user, in particular wherein the insert 7 is firmly coupled to the mounting element 2, and wherein the set screws 13 have been previously positioned within the respective receiving seats 70, and preferably the set screws 13 have been partially screwed into the pre-mounting holes 71A, in order to arrange these components and hold them in the correct pre-mounting position.
The support device 1 can be fixed to the side F of the furniture piece by using said reference means 8, in particular by bringing said coupling flange 21 close to the inner surface F1 of the furniture piece near its lower edge, and positioning said support flange 22 at the lower edge surface F2.
Subsequently, pre-mounting of the device 1 on the side portion F is achieved by introducing reference teeth from the lower edge surface F2, said reference teeth 23 being press-fitted into the thickness portion of the side portion F until said support flange 22 substantially abuts the side portion.
At this time, the support device 1 can be fixed to the side F by inserting the screws 13 into the corresponding fixing holes 21A provided on the coupling flange 21 and passing them through them until they are completely screwed into the side F, which screws are advantageously arranged in advance at the pre-installation positions inside the respective housing seats 70 of the insert 7.
As shown in fig. 4, after the support device 1 is stably fixed to the side F of the furniture piece, a horizontal plate B, which forms the bottom of the furniture piece, may be arranged above the support device, which is preferably provided with a hole adapted to be formed through the thickness of the horizontal plate, to allow access to the adjustment device 3 using a tool, so that the desired adjustment can be made.
In summary, the support device 1 according to the invention clearly achieves the aims and advantages initially proposed. In particular, an adjustable support device for furniture resting on the ground has been obtained which allows an adjustment in height of the position of the furniture piece and provides a plurality of solutions making it absolutely practical and powerful.
In particular, the presence of the insert 7 allows to provide the support device 1 with a fixing device most suitable for the particular application, which advantageously has been pre-assembled in place in order to facilitate and rapidly fix the support device to the side F of the piece of furniture.
Furthermore, in this way, the assembly technician can be encouraged to use the provided fixing means, avoiding assembly errors that could damage the sides of the furniture piece and affect the durability of the support means.
Furthermore, the presence of the connection means 6 is advantageously formed in two separate half-shells, each provided with an associated threaded portion, to allow the connection means 6 to be adapted to be mounted on the rod 31 without screwing, simply by positioning the first half-shell along the rod 31 and then positioning the other half-shell to the rod 31. This allows to form an interruption of the thread 20B in the upper end portion of the connecting means 6, defining an end of stroke suitable for preventing the complete unscrewing of said adjustment means 3 from the mounting element 2.
